Didn't get your exact question but SIB1 carries information related to a cell which is being allowed to access to the UE such as PLMN-ID,Cell-ID,TAI,cell barred information,cell selection information and scheduling information of the other system informations.
So some parameters are optionals and some parameter are mandatory in SIB1.
Cant specify the exact size of SIB1 but depend on ASN.1 encoder and value of the parameter number of acquired bits will be calculated.
For example CSG-Indication is a boolean so it will take only single bit to represent it,TrackingAreaCode is BIT STRING of size 16 but number of bits allocated for this parameter is based on the value as if value is 5 then only 3 bits are required to represent the Tracking AreaCode.